college mission
Learning the Healer's Art

The mission of the Brigham Young University College of Nursing is to develop professional nurses who:
  • Promote Health
  • Care for the Suffering
  • Engage in the Scholarship of the Discipline
  • Invite the Spirit in to Health and Healing
  • Lead with Faith and Integrity

We are community of scholars engaged in the discovery and application of the Healer's art to strengthen health and healing worldwide and to enhance the discipline of nursing.
